What "accredited" really means

In Australia, CPR and emergency treatment systems come under the nationwide veterinarian structure. If you are booking a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course North Lakes, seek the unit codes. For m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, the current device is typically HLTAID009 Supply cardiopulmonary resuscitation. Many workplaces still inquire about HLTAID001 out of routine, however HLTAID009 supersedes it. For incorporated emergency treatment, the common unit is HLTAID011 Provide Emergency Treatment, which includes the CPR component.

When you see North Lakes first aid training courses marketed as certified, verify that the company is a Registered Training Organisation or partnered with one. Request for the RTO number and check the units on your registration confirmation. Employers and regulators care about that positioning. If you require an emergency treatment certification North Lakes for child care or education and learning, you may need HLTAID012 Provide First Aid in an education and learning and care setup, which increases the child‑specific scenarios.

A great company, whether it is Initial Help Pro North Lakes or another long‑standing local team, will certainly inform you in advance which units you will get and how the assessment functions. You must get a Declaration of Attainment that details the systems and RTO details, commonly provided online within 24 to two days as soon as you have met the criteria.

What top quality CPR feels and look like

CPR is straightforward to define and hard to do for more than two minutes. The metric that makes the biggest distinction is compressions, not breaths. You aim for 100 to 120 compressions per minute, regarding one 3rd the breast deepness, allowing complete recoil. If that seems abstract, in a course you will suspend loud and match your speed to a metronome or a tune you already understand with the ideal tempo. I have actually seen excellent instructors utilize a timer and tag‑team pupils every 2 minutes to keep the high quality up. That mirrors reality. Solo CPR becomes sloppy when you are worn down, so swapping rescuer roles is a skill too.

The AED is the various other half of contemporary m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. Every cpr training courses North Lakes alternative worth your time ought to have AED instructors and technique pads. You do not require to memorize rhythms. The device walks you via. What you need is experience with switching it on, positioning the pads quickly on a perspiring breast, removing onlookers so no one gets a shock, and pushing the flashing switch when informed. In a mall or school, those couple of smooth actions cut seconds.

You will certainly likewise cover variants. On a kid or infant, compressions are shallower and breaths matter much more, but you still press, still go for rhythm, and still use an AED if readily available with paediatric setups. Trainers need to show how to improvise in limited rooms or on soft surface areas and speak through when to quit, such as when the person shows signs of life or a paramedic takes over.

What the assessment actually involves

Assessment needs to seem like a practical drill, not a method. For m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, expect a situation similar to this: you approach a manikin, check for risk, shake and shout, call for help, send a person for the AED, begin compressions, and continue for two minutes while passing over loud. The fitness instructor enjoys your price, deepness, and recoil. You will also demonstrate breaths utilizing barrier gadgets, then switch to the AED when it arrives. Some courses make use of feedback manikins that reveal whether your compressions hit targets, which helps you adjust the feel.

For first aid, situations tip past CPR. You could manage a bleeding forearm with a stress bandage, then improvisate a tourniquet. You might place a client with presumed shock or an asthma assault and carry out a reducer puffer with a spacer. Fitness instructors usually ask you to verbalize your actions as you go, not as a memory examination, but to show your reasoning.

Online theory assessments check your understanding of task of care, infection control, legal factors to consider, and condition‑specific indicators. Take the theory seriously. It shortens class time and offers you language for your work environment occurrence reports later.

The trade‑offs and edge cases that matter

CPR on a bed falls short because the mattress absorbs your pressure. If you discover an individual less competent on a bed, slide a board under them or relocate them to the flooring ideally. This feels uncomfortable, however half‑depth compressions save no one. In a confined bathroom, stooping area may force you to angle your body. You will certainly find out to readjust hand positioning and still keep rhythm.

Breaths split viewpoint. Some individuals worry about infection risk. Barrier gadgets assist, and devices show pocket mask usage. If you are unwilling or not able to provide breaths, do hands‑only compressions and make use of the AED. Something beats nothing, and breast compressions maintain blood relocating to the brain. In paediatric apprehensions, breaths bring more weight, so training consists of baby and youngster methods. Knowing the difference aids you pick under pressure.

EpiPens are risk-free even when you are not totally certain it is anaphylaxis. The risk of hold-up is higher than the danger of a dose that ends up unneeded. Excellent programs in emergency treatment North Lakes cover this clinical reasoning with case studies. Asthma and anaphylaxis can look comparable when the respiratory tract tightens up, and sometimes they happen with each other. Your task is to adhere to action plans if readily available, provide oxygen if trained and available, and deal with worsening symptoms promptly.

image

In blood loss control, tourniquets are not a last option. If straight stress fails or the limb hemorrhage is extreme, use a tourniquet high and limited. Modern training demystifies this and gives you the method to do it decisively. It is challenging the very first time, however it saves lives in the uncommon however real extreme trauma occasions on roads or worksites.
